# Japan master trust and custody bank landscape

## Overview

Japan's master-trust / custody-bank landscape is a two-anchor domestic infrastructure layer: [[trust-banks/master-trust-bank|Master Trust Bank of Japan]] and [[trust-banks/custody-bank|Custody Bank of Japan]]. They are not "investors" in the ordinary sense; they are asset-administration banks for pensions, investment trusts, insurers, asset managers, and institutional investors.

## Landscape Map

| Institution | Shareholder / group logic | Functional reading |
|---|---|---|
| [[trust-banks/master-trust-bank|Master Trust Bank of Japan]] | MUFG trust + major life / cooperative finance shareholders. | Asset-administration specialist and major "trust account" nominee name. |
| [[trust-banks/custody-bank|Custody Bank of Japan]] | Sumitomo Mitsui Trust / Mizuho / insurer-linked custody consolidation route. | Asset-administration specialist and major "trust account" nominee name. |
| [[foreign-financial-institutions/bny-mellon-japan|BNY Mellon Japan]] | Global custody / securities services group. | Global-custody, asset-servicing, and foreign-investor bridge. |
| [[foreign-financial-institutions/state-street-japan|State Street Japan]] | Global custody / asset-servicing group. | Global-custody and institutional services bridge. |
| Full-service trust banks | MUFG Trust, Mizuho Trust, SMTB, SMBC Trust. | Wider trust / estate / real estate / pension / securities-agency functions. |

Sources: institution type, ownership, and disclosed business functions come from the current MTBJ and CBJ company/business pages and the FSA trust-bank list. ## What They Actually Do

| Workstream | Description |
|---|---|
| Safekeeping and settlement | Hold and settle stocks, bonds, funds, and foreign assets under client instruction. |
| Corporate actions | Process dividends, splits, conversions, redemptions, elections, and notifications. |
| Fund / pension accounting | Calculate holdings, valuations, reports, and asset-owner records. |
| Global-custody coordination | Connect domestic clients to overseas custodians and overseas assets. |
| Securities lending support | Administer lending programs and collateral / recall processes where applicable. |
| Middle / back-office outsourcing | Support asset managers and institutional investors with operational services. |

## Why Filings Show Their Names

Major-shareholder tables often show names such as "Master Trust Bank of Japan, Ltd. (trust account)" or "Custody Bank of Japan, Ltd. (trust account)." That usually means:

1. the trust / custody bank is the legal / record name;
2. the economic beneficial owners are pensions, funds, insurers, asset managers, or other clients;
3. voting and investment decisions usually follow client / manager instruction;
4. the trust bank's AUC / AuA is not proprietary capital.

This rule is critical when reading [[banking/INDEX|banking INDEX]], issuer filings, cross-shareholding analysis, and governance pages.

## Research Checklist

1. Check whether a custody bank reference is an entity page, a shareholder nominee name, or an asset-servicing mandate.
2. Use official company pages for current business lines and AUC / AuA figures.
3. Treat Trust Companies Association statistics as domain-level background, not company-specific share unless clearly stated.
4. Link stock lending, voting, and corporate-action questions to the correct specialist page.
5. Avoid claiming beneficial ownership from nominee-name appearance alone.
